Context

After careful consideration of a series of factors such as the product and technology roadmap, company culture, and of course the available budget, the decision was clear: offshoring was the perfect solution. And India was the winner !

The global business strategy already articulated in projects was to fully offshore in India within a time horizon of 2-3 years. Currently, software engineering and customer support are fully located in Europe.

Let’s assume that we can create a decent software development team in India during this time span.

People working within the dedicated offshore team are not likely to become overnight experts on highly specialized software. The complexity of the product and the industry are important barriers to entry.

Some offshore people never heard of the product and have zero industry experience, but they are savvy enough to get things progressing. They are able to resolve basic tasks in a reasonable time frame.

Some in-house onshore experts can still be used for review, support, or expertise matter escalations.

Offshoring vs. Onshoring Price

Today, the onshore and offshore price tags may be similar, for the highly specialized skills.

For the sake of simplification, I decided to choose some median figures that do not necessarily reflect today’s reality of the field.

In the following example, I considered that software development costs are 10 times cheaper in India than in Europe.

A practical example

Let’s count a cost of $40/day for the offshore resource. Because the onshore expert resource is 10 times more expensive, the cost is a minimum of $400/day for the onshore resource. We also apply the standard rate of 8 hours per working day.

In this real-life example, an easy and simple task is assigned to the in-house, offshore development centre.

The offshore resource is spending 3 days working on that issue with not much result. Additionally, the offshore resource needs 2 extra days for supplementary work like learning, clarifications, rework, and several reminders of the due date.

So, the cost is:

The offshore team

5 days of work @ $40/day = $200 paid to offshore

- limited-skills task,
- the work package not delivered, 
- no results within the agreed time frame, 
- exceeded budget considering the location.

Due to the late delivery, the final customer is starting to escalate the issue to higher management and he is unhappy. Because the offshore resource did not provide a tangible result, the onshore resource team is assigned to work on the same task.

In only 1 hour, the work is delivered by the onshore team. For this onshore work, the cost is:

The onshore team

1 hour of work @ $400/day = $50 paid to onshore

- the same limited-skills task,
- the work package quickly delivered in only 1 hour, 
- on-time and less than initial budget, 
- very cheap price considering the location.

For the same task, we pay $200 to offshore and only $50 to onshore.

The total cost to deliver this task to the end-user is $250. Roughly speaking, it is often a double payment for the same task. Where is the catch ?

Why offshore is sometimes more expensive than onshore ?

Offshore price is indeed 10 times cheaper for software coding, but the offshore resource takes much more time to deliver few results. Offshore budgets would very likely explode to 3 months when the issue to solve is highly complex.

It all comes down to productivity and not only to basic hourly cost computation.

In this real-life example, the offshore IT development centre is lacking the expertise and they are also too slow when delivering results.

When considering the real cost, a business organization should also take into account:

  • the steep learning curve of a complex software product
  • and the substantial offshore run-up costs involved with offshore.

In this particular case, it is unrealistic to think that 6 months of fast training can replace the value of 15 to 20 years of onshore expertise and continuous training.

Substantial offshore run-up costs cannot replace 15 yrs of onshore product expertise.

Outsourcing complex products based on the price element alone is a strategic move that needs more in-depth consideration.

Other hidden costs

Provided that the process and Capability Maturity Model (CMMI) is level 5 (optimizing), then an offshoring software coding activity can be outsourced very effectively, no matter the complexity of the product. In the real world, few business organizations acquired this maximum maturity level.

Offshore outsourcing is a viable solution for quite “basic” software development such as e-commerce coding, apps coding, and basic pieces of software.

When the software coding is highly complex and industry-specific, then a full IT offshoring may not be the right strategic move.

As we saw in the above example, the offshore cost is substantial.

Offshoring may not be the right strategy for complex software coding and specialized industry.

The ROI is negative in fact.

Indeed, for the 2-4 years term, while partially transferring the highly specialized know-how, the offshore team is more costly than the in-house onshore team. Added to this are supplementary friction points arising between onshore – offshore – customers.

The final price of the software product will paradoxically be more expensive for the final customer.

Other factors

Some might argue that the offshore team will quickly learn because they have little margin to negotiate.

When outsourcing your company-specific IT expertise, carefully consider and mitigate your strategic risks.

However, during this transition phase and afterwards, other strategic risks may arise.

Those risks are important in the banking software industry:

  • industry landscape may change (disruption, other actors on the market, etc)
  • regulatory and legal requests (mainly the data confidentiality)
  • country-specific risks (political, economic, culture, etc.)
  • human-resource-related risks (data leakage, confidentiality breach, etc)
  • important customers may leave.

Moreover, the risk of losing key onshore competencies and offshore talent is higher than usual. Very often, offshore people abandon due to the complexity and unrealistic requests. Meanwhile, onshore expert resources are leaving.

Not lately, B2B customers are more eager to ask for a substantial price reduction considering that the IT “production price” has decreased. After a contract re-negotiation, the supplier business can end up with a less interesting market and a lower brand positioning from a financial point of view.

Especially in the banking industry, the end customer does not particularly appreciate it when a core software product is being coded elsewhere, in a distant offshore location.

Finally, the strategic move to fully offshore IT can be disastrous for the whole business.

Possible solutions:

IT project costs estimates often miscalculate additional hidden costs when outsourcing.

When deciding to completely outsource to offshore locations your IT tasks like software coding and support teams, take into account those facts.

1 – do not forget about the hidden costs

On top of your project cost control, include also the productivity, additional supervision and governance fees, and quality control in your computations.

The costs estimates of an IT project often miscalculate those hidden costs.

2 – control the coding quality

The software coding quality has to be computed for the long term and in terms of business image.

The lack of quality in the software coding has also a business cost that can be computed.

Do this calculation for the long term and with a constant view of the business as a whole. A tremendous number of bugs and urgent fixes needed will easily frustrate B2B customers and hence, damage the brand perception.

Indeed, the unhappy customers will only see a bad piece of software. Moreover, a supplementary cost is involved on their side to escalate the increased number of software bugs.

The final customers do not care that you paid 10 times less for your software development teams. Neither if they had a price discount.

3 – consider the delivery schedules

Delivering your piece of software at a later date, or too late also impacts your business image towards your B2B customers.

So, keep an eye on your delivery schedules. Invest in proper governance able to efficiently control the offshore divergences.

4 – mitigate your strategic risks

Careful analysis and mitigation plans for diverse risks encountered by the business before, during the transfer stage, and also during the operation stage should be in place.

Strategic costs need to be calculated with a long-term view. Be very careful about the risks of data leakage and data breach on offshore sites, as well as country-specific risks.

Sometimes, onshore software development can be quicker, hassle-free, and cheaper for everyone.

Conclusion

The competitive price tag of offshoring is a major argument when deciding on a global strategy. But should the price tag be the only element on which top-level strategic decisions should be taken ?

The answer is dependent on the project type, the size of your business, and the complexity of your software coding. Price should not be the only element. Experience, reliability, and on-time project-management skills are also important.

As we quickly reviewed, onshore software development can be quicker, hassle-free, and cheaper for everyone when we are facing complex software coding and a specialized industry like the banking software industry.

From a business point of view, it is a strategic non-sense to break an existing organization and onshore specialized teams just to pay more to offshore locations, work more, increase business risks, and reduce the overall profit.
